Michelle McCune artist and conservationist.

Reaching out and scratching the hide of Sudan – the last male northern white rhinoceros – at Ol Pejeta Conservancy in Kenya in 2016, profoundly encapsulates Dr. Michelle McCune’s mission as an artist. Her work centers on animals in their wild habitats, highlighting their lives and their challenges.

Currently based in northern California, Michelle developed a strong connection with animals early in life. Her passion for animals led her to a career in veterinary medicine. 

While in veterinary school, Michelle was fortunate enough to travel to Namibia in 1993 and work with the Cheetah Conservation Fund. This trip ignited a passion in her for conservation efforts and the flora and fauna of the African continent. Although she didn’t start painting until 2001, her first subjects were from this trip, and wildlife became the ongoing theme of her work. 

All of her work is based on experiences from her travels and direct encounters with animals. She takes photographs which are used as anchors to her memories, then returns home to her studio to recreate a moment in time using oil paints on canvas. Her paintings provide the viewer with a bridge into the world of marvelous animals portrayed, prompting reflection on personal experiences and connection to nature.

Dr. McCune’s work has received many awards and been internationally recognized. She is a signature member of the Artists for Conservation.

Days 3 - Selenkay Conservancy

Your adventure begins with an early breakfast before heading to Nairobi’s Wilson Airport for a scenic 40-minute flight to the private airstrip at Selenkay Conservancy, part of the greater Amboseli ecosystem. Upon landing, your Maasai guide will meet you for your first game drive — a thrilling introduction to Kenya’s wildlife — as you make your way to Porini Amboseli Camp, your home for the next two nights.

After settling in and enjoying a freshly prepared lunch, you’ll set out on an escorted walk to a nearby Maasai village. This is a rare opportunity to step into the daily rhythm of the community, learning first-hand about their traditions, stories, and deep connection to the land.

As the afternoon unfolds, you’ll venture back into Selenkay Conservancy — a protected haven known for its thriving populations of big cats, elephants, giraffes, zebra, and antelopes. Keep an eye out for the conservancy’s rarer residents too, including the elegant gerenuk, elusive lesser kudu, and the African wildcat.

As the sun dips behind the iconic silhouette of Mount Kilimanjaro, pause for a classic safari sundowner at a breathtaking viewpoint. The day doesn’t end there — once darkness falls, you’ll embark on an exciting night game drive, offering a chance to spot nocturnal wildlife rarely seen by day. Return to Porini Amboseli Camp for a delicious dinner and fall asleep to the sounds of the African night.

How close can we get to wildlife?

Very close, sometimes within 10-20 feet, but never at the expense of safety or animal welfare. This is made possible by highly trained, certified guides who read animal behaviour in real time and reposition or pull away immediately if any signs of stress are detected.

The priority is always respect for the wildlife first, with great images coming as a result of patience, space and ethical judgement rather than proximity alone.
